Ticket #4412 — Vaultkeep locked during reset-flow revamp. While testing the new password reset flow for the Brindlewood plugin API, the staging vault sealed itself after three failed unseal attempts. Plugin authors: do not retry unseal calls in a loop; the revamped flow treats bursts as hostile and extends the lockout window. We have verified the recovery path works end to end. To unseal a locked vault during testing, use the recovery passphrase below.

strongbox words: wenix-ulador

**Runbook: Ledgerpane audit-log viewer — release cut**

Scope: read-only viewer, no writes to the audit store. Freeze ingestion before cutover; the Ledgerpane indexer must drain in under five minutes or abort. Verify retention flag is 90d, not the old 30d default. Smoke test: open any tenant, filter by actor, confirm export works. Rollback is a single image pin; no migrations ship with this release. The viewer reads the audit store through a scoped service credential, set in the .env file on the next line.

secret setting of bajeg-yahog: LEDGER_TOKEN20=f833f3e2e6625ec0dee3

**CI note: timezone weirdness in report exports**

Heads up, support folks — if a customer says their Ledgerpine export shows times shifted by a few hours, it's probably the CI image. The export workers got rebuilt last week and the base image defaults to UTC, while older workers used the account's locale. Fix is rolling out; meanwhile tell customers the data itself is fine, just the display offset. Affected exports carry the build token shown below.

build token for bajof-tahop: htk4_a981